Report: Barcelona players feel 'undervalued' by Lionel Messi

The Argentine wanted to leave the Catalan giants at the end of last season as he was unhappy with the former president Josep Maria Bartomeu and the board.

However, Messi changed his mind about after deciding not to go into a legal battle with the club in order to force his departure.

Spanish publication Mundo Deportivo have reported that the transfer saga has 'disrupted' the dressing room while results on the field have not been up to par.

The report is also adds that several members of the first team feel undervalued by the six-time Ballon d'Or winner.

Messi's future remains up for debate as his contract expires at the end of the season while there has been no indication of an extension.

Paris Saint-Germain star Neymar also recently claimed he would like to play alongside Messi once again, fuelling speculation that he could make the switch to French capital.
